ὀπόεις · opoeis — LSJ

juicy

juicy, ἐρινοί Nic. Al. 319.

II Opus

as place name, Opus, Il. 2.531, IG 9(1).334.33 (v B. C.), etc. ; Ὀπούντιοι, οἱ, name of a section of the Locrians, Th. 1.108, etc. ; Locr. Ὁπούντιοι SIG 597 B 2 ; also Ὁπόντιοι IG 9(1).334.39, and uncontr. Ὁποέντιος ib. 7.393.2 (Oropus).
